Sister School

Exchange programs with Le Arti Orafe,Jewelry School, Firenze - Italy

 

●Sister school - Le Arti Orafe

Mr. Gio Carbone, principal of Le Arti Orafe, a prestige jewelry school in Firenze in Italy visited our school, and concluded an agreement for exchange programs such as overseas study, summer course and exchange of works and teaching materials with our school.

●Commemorative seminar

A commemorative seminar was held at the hall in Tokyo on December 5. About two hundred audience, students of Tokyo school and other schools and staff members participated in the seminar.
The seminar included a lecture with a projector on the subject of “Jewelry of the Renaissance period in Firenze” and a brief presentation of Le Arti Orafe such as description of classes and students’ works. His rewarding and enjoyable lecture gave participants great satisfaction.


●Admission to Le Arti Orafe in Italy

This exchange program is good news especially to students who intend to study in Italy. Graduates from the two-year full time course and the two-year general regular course could be admitted to Le Arti Orafe as special students.
